A collaborative manipulation strategy to enhance the sodium ion storage capability of Prussian white cathodes
Zhibin Zhang1,2,3,4, Yuan Gao1,2,3,4, Jing Gao2,3,4
1School of Materials Science and Engineering, Qingdao University of Science and Technology, 53 Zhengzhou Rd., Qingdao, Shandong 266042, P. R. China.
Abstract:
A collaborative manipulation strategy of proper heat treatment and self-customized hydrofluoroether-based electrolyte design has been proposed for boosting the sodium-ion storage kinetics of Prussian white cathodes. Improved monoclinic phase stability and electrolyte-cathode compatibility are responsible for an impressive discharge capacity of 148.4 mA h g-1 and excellent electrode reversibility.
